An octagonal quasicrystal structure model with 83 screw axes

Abstract

An atomic structure model for an octagonal quasicrystal is proposed, based on the analysis of the related crystalline β-Mn structure. A salient feature is the occurrence of local 83 screw axes. The density and the closest inter-atomic distance are within 5% difference of those of the β-Mn structure. This structural model agrees well with experimental results obtained by electron microscopy and electron diffraction.
